MP's Ex-Husband Released in Cohen Murder Case

A suspect in the murder case of Dutch tycoon Tob Cohen was released under tough conditions on Tuesday, October 29, 2019.

Hot 96 FM reported that Peter Karanja, was freed on a Ksh2 million cash bail.

His case was also scheduled for mention on November 12, 2019.

Karanja is the former husband to Gilgil MP Martha Wangari. Wangari on Friday, October 25, denied an assertion he would live at their Gilgil home, once he was released.

Through her lawyer George Kimani, the lawmaker denied that Karanja also owned the home in question.

"The Gilgil home is subject to several court cases on ownership," the court heard.

Another suspect, Sarah Wairimu Cohen, the deceased's widow, is also out on bail.

On Friday, October 11, Wairimu was released an a Ksh2 million cash bail or Ksh4 million bond with the court issuing three tough conditions for her release.

She was ordered not to set foot at her Kitisuru home which was declared a crime scene.
